Co to znaczy, że mikrokontroler jest 32-bitowy?

W tym artykule nauczymy Cię o 32-bitowych mikrokontrolerach i ich znaczeniu we współczesnych systemach komputerowych. Omówimy, co to znaczy, że mikrokontroler jest 32-bitowy, jaki ma to wpływ na wydajność i jak wypada na tle innych architektur. Zrozumienie tych koncepcji jest niezbędne przy wyborze odpowiedniego mikrokontrolera do Twoich projektów i aplikacji.

Co to znaczy, że mikrokontroler jest 32-bitowy?

Kiedy mikrokontroler jest określany jako 32-bitowy, oznacza to, że szyna danych, szyna adresowa i rejestry procesora mają szerokość 32 bitów. Oznacza to, że mikrokontroler może przetwarzać 32 bity danych jednocześnie w jednym cyklu rozkazowym. Dzięki temu urządzenie może obsługiwać większe liczby i więcej pamięci jednocześnie w porównaniu z mikrokontrolerami o niższej liczbie bitów, takimi jak opcje 8- lub 16-bitowe. W związku z tym 32-bitowy mikrokontroler lepiej nadaje się do zastosowań wymagających złożonych obliczeń, wielozadaniowości lub obsługi większych zbiorów danych.

Co to jest mikrokontroler 32-bitowy?

Mikrokontroler 32-bitowy to typ mikrokontrolera zaprojektowany do przetwarzania danych w 32-bitowych fragmentach. Architektura ta pozwala na lepszą wydajność w aplikacjach wymagających większej ilości pamięci i mocy obliczeniowej. Takie mikrokontrolery są zwykle wyposażone w większą adresowalną przestrzeń pamięci, co pozwala im wykorzystać do 4 gigabajtów pamięci RAM. Mikrokontrolery 32-bitowe są powszechnie stosowane w zastosowaniach takich jak samochodowe systemy sterowania, urządzenia medyczne i elektronika użytkowa, gdzie kluczowa jest wyższa wydajność i funkcjonalność.

Co to jest telefon społecznościowy?

Co to znaczy, że system jest 32-bitowy?

Aby system był 32-bitowy, oznacza to, że architektura systemu wykorzystuje 32-bitowe szyny danych, adresy i możliwości przetwarzania. Architektura ta określa ilość danych, jaką procesor może obsłużyć za jednym razem, oraz maksymalną adresowalną przestrzeń pamięci. System 32-bitowy teoretycznie może uzyskać dostęp do aż 4 GB RAM-u, pozwalając na sprawną obsługę aplikacji wymagających większej ilości pamięci. Jest to szczególnie korzystne w przypadku uruchamiania nowoczesnych systemów operacyjnych i oprogramowania, które wymagają większej mocy obliczeniowej.

Co to są bity w mikrokontrolerze?

Bity w mikrokontrolerze odnoszą się do podstawowych jednostek danych, gdzie każdy bit może przyjmować wartość 0 lub 1. Liczba bitów w architekturze mikrokontrolera (takiej jak 8-bitowa, 16-bitowa lub 32-bitowa) określa ile danych mikrokontroler może przetworzyć jednocześnie i ile unikalnych wartości może reprezentować. Na przykład 32-bitowy mikrokontroler może reprezentować 2^32 (około 4,3 miliarda) różnych wartości, dzięki czemu nadaje się do bardziej złożonych zastosowań w porównaniu do mikrokontrolerów z mniejszą liczbą bitów.

Co to są instrukcje rozgałęziające?

Jaka jest różnica między wersją 64-bitową a 32-bitową?

Podstawowa różnica między architekturami 64-bitowymi i 32-bitowymi polega na możliwościach przetwarzania danych. Architektura 64-bitowa może przetwarzać dane w 64-bitowych fragmentach, umożliwiając obsługę większych liczb i dostęp do znacznie większej przestrzeni pamięci — teoretycznie do 16 eksabajtów. Natomiast architektura 32-bitowa jest ograniczona do 4 GB adresowalnej pamięci i może obsłużyć tylko 32 bity danych jednocześnie. W rezultacie systemy 64-bitowe są na ogół bardziej wydajne, co pozwala na bardziej efektywną wielozadaniowość i uruchamianie aplikacji wymagających dużych zasobów, podczas gdy systemy 32-bitowe mogą być odpowiednie do prostszych zadań.

Co to jest Arduino Pro Micro?

Mamy nadzieję, że to wyjaśnienie pomogło ci zrozumieć implikacje 32-bitowych mikrokontrolerów i znaczenie bitów w architekturze mikrokontrolera. Zrozumienie tych koncepcji może pomóc w podejmowaniu świadomych decyzji dotyczących projektów technologicznych.

QR Code
📱